			<description><![CDATA[<p>Seeing this made me wonder if an unusually high number of people won. The jackpot was estimated as $60,000, but 49 people won that day, so each won only $1,266.<br /><br />Any set of numbers is just as likely to be drawn as another, but the choice of numbers can still affect whether a jackpot is shared, or how widely. An obvious set, such as 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, is no less likely to win, but it does make it more likely you&#x27;ll have to share a jackpot.</p>]]></description>
